“This research has shown the diverse use of these unique ceramic vessels which include ancientPrevious research into the containers had indicated that they were used for a variety of purposes such as for beer drinking, mercury and oil containers, and medicine bowls.
“These vessels have been reported during the time of the Crusades as grenades thrown against Crusader strongholds producing loud noises and bright flashes of light," added Matheson.and held black powder, an explosive invented in ancient China and known to have been introduced into the Middle East and Europe by the 13th century.
“However, this research has shown that it is not black powder and likely a locally invented explosive material.”Matheson also added that his work revealed that some of these vessels had been sealed using resin. Now, he says more study needs to be conducted on the vessels to truly understand the explosive technology behind them.
